Honors, Awards and Distinctions

Fellow of SPIE, for contributions in areas of surface scatter phenomena and phased telescope arrays (1989).

Harvey-Thompson grazing incidence X-ray telescope design adopted by NOAA for Solar X-ray Imager (SXI)

instrument on GOES weather satellite (Dec 1998). Four flight models and a spare manufactured by Raytheon Optical

systems, Inc. on Lockheed Martin SXI program (1999-2004). Received outstanding achievement award from

Lockheed Martin Solar and Astrophysics Laboratory (LMSAL) in March 2005. First SXI telescope successfully

launched on GOES-13 by a Delta IV rocket in May 2006. First light image recorded on July 6, 2006. Image described as

exquisite by one solar physicist on July 8, 2006.

Chosen as an outside, independent imaging expert to review NASA s Implementation Plan for the Return-to-Flight of

the Space Shuttle after the 2003 Columbia disaster upon re-entering the earth s atmosphere in February of 2003.

Papers reprinted in three different Volumes of SPIE's Milestone Series of Selected Papers on . . ., Edited by Brian J.

Thompson (P6 on Scalar Diffraction Theory, C12 on Adaptive Optics, and C48 on Surface Scatter Phenomena).

The Harvey-Shack Surface Scatter Model has been incorporated into four different (ASAP, TracePro, ZEMAX and

FRED) commercially-available optical design and analysis codes.
